What are Amino Acids and Why Do Plants Need Them?
Amino acids are organic molecules composed of carbon, hydrogen, oxygen, and nitrogen, forming the essential units that construct proteins. In plants, proteins are vital for virtually all physiological processes, including enzyme activity, hormone synthesis, and structural integrity. While plants can synthesize many amino acids internally, external application, particularly of readily available L-amino acids, can provide a significant growth advantage. These compounds act as biostimulants, directly influencing metabolic pathways and bolstering plant vigor.
Key Benefits of Amino Acid Fertilizers for Agriculture
The advantages of incorporating amino acid fertilizers into your nutrient management program are multifaceted. Sourcing these from a reliable manufacturer ensures you receive a product that delivers maximum efficacy. Here are the primary benefits:
1. Enhanced Nutrient Uptake: Amino acids act as natural chelating agents. They form complexes with essential minerals like iron, zinc, and manganese, preventing them from becoming insoluble and unavailable in the soil. This chelation significantly boosts the plant's ability to absorb these vital micronutrients, leading to improved overall nutrition and healthier growth. 2. Improved Stress Tolerance: Plants frequently encounter environmental stressors such as drought, salinity, extreme temperatures, and pest or disease pressure. Amino acids, particularly proline and glycine, play a crucial role in mitigating these effects. They help maintain cell turgor, protect cellular structures, and bolster the plant's natural defense mechanisms. 3. Stimulation of Growth and Development: Amino acids are precursors for plant hormones and growth regulators. For instance, tryptophan is a precursor to auxins, crucial for cell division and elongation. Glycine and glutamic acid are involved in chlorophyll synthesis, enhancing photosynthesis. This direct support for growth processes results in stronger root systems, more vigorous foliage, improved flowering, and ultimately, higher yields. 4. Direct Energy Source: When plants are under stress or require rapid development, they can utilize free amino acids as a direct energy source, saving valuable metabolic energy that would otherwise be spent on synthesizing them from scratch. This saved energy can be redirected towards growth, flowering, or fruit production.

Application Methods for Optimal Results
Amino acid fertilizers are highly versatile and can be applied through various methods:
- Foliar Spray: Provides rapid absorption and immediate benefits, ideal for quick nutrient boosts or stress recovery.
- Soil Application/Drench: Enhances soil structure, supports beneficial microbial activity, and provides sustained nutrient release.
- Seed Treatment: Promotes robust germination and early seedling vigor, setting a strong foundation for the crop.
